Bozrah, Connecticut, is a rural community that appeals to those seeking a quieter lifestyle with city conveniences nearby. Located west of Norwich, Bozrah is known for its low crime risk, being safer than the national average. The town offers a range of home styles, including modest ranch-style and raised ranch houses, Cape Cods, and Colonial-style homes, many set on multiple acres with features like bay windows and finished basements. Recreational opportunities abound with Maple Farm Park's 3.5 miles of hiking and horseback riding trails, and Hopemead State Park's access to Gardner Lake for boating and swimming. Dining options include Main’s Country Store and Grill, Bozrah Pizza, and Zayla’a Bar and Bistro, while shopping is conveniently located in nearby Norwich. The Bozrah Farmers Market, held from July to October, is a community hub for fresh produce and local goods. Educationally, Bozrah students can attend Norwich Free Academy, a highly rated high school. While public transportation is limited, major routes connect Bozrah to Norwich and beyond. However, potential buyers should be aware of flooding risks near the Yantic River, as evidenced by a recent dam break. Overall, Bozrah provides a balance of rural charm and accessibility, making it a practical choice for commuters to Hartford and the Connecticut coast.
On average, homes in Bozrah, CT sell after 64 days on the market compared to the national average of 52 days. The median sale price for homes in Bozrah, CT over the last 12 months is $365,000, down 9% from the median home sale price over the previous 12 months.
